It was a Friday, I was in the 9th grade. I was changing classes during the 2:30 period break when a friend yelled the news to me across the heads of my classmates. I recall the commotion of every rushing to change classes, many oblivious to what was being yelled out. There are always a few moments in one's life that are always clear and sharp. This is one of those for me.

I was three years old. President Kennedy was the first "famous person" I had any knowledge of. My name was Jon, and I was the same age as John-John. I remember watching the funeral procession. I remember watching as Jack Ruby shot Oswald on live TV. I remember falling in love with Caroline Kennedy. She was so different from all the little girls in my neighborhood. She always was dressed up in these beautiful outfits. Like a princess.
